Pathfinder: Treasure Vault (Remastered) is Paizo’s definitive compendium of magical arms, armor, gear, and artifacts for the updated Remaster ruleset. More than just a catalogue of equipment, it frames treasure as a storytelling device, offering new options for characters, guidance for Game Masters, and flavorful lore behind iconic items. It updates and refines the 2023 edition of Treasure Vault, aligning all material with the streamlined Remaster rules.
⚔️ What’s Inside
Across its 224 pages, the book provides:
- Weapons & Armor: New and reimagined designs, enhanced to fit the Remaster’s simplified trait system.
- Consumables & Adventuring Gear: Alchemical concoctions, wondrous items, and magical tools designed to encourage creative play.
- Relics & Artifacts: High-level rewards steeped in lore, with guidance on weaving them into ongoing campaigns.
- Customization Tools: Modular enchantments and flexible rules for tailoring items to your character’s concept.
- Lore & Flavor: Sidebars and descriptions that situate items within Golarion’s cultures and histories.
The result is a resource that works as both equipment catalogue and narrative inspiration.

⚠️ Things to Consider
- Overlap with Original Edition: Owners of the first Treasure Vault may find much of the material familiar, though updated.
- System Specificity: As with all Pathfinder 2e content, the material is tightly bound to Paizo’s mechanics, limiting cross-system portability.
- Reference-Heavy: While flavorful, the book is primarily a rules reference; it may not captivate those seeking narrative-focused supplements.
🏰 Place in the Pathfinder Line

The Treasure Vault (Remastered) sits alongside other foundational Pathfinder 2e Remaster releases such as Player Core and GM Core. While not required to play, it deepens character customization and provides GMs with tools to keep campaigns fresh. For groups invested in long-term campaigns, it’s a natural expansion. For casual tables, it may serve as a well-produced “treasure chest” of optional content.
